Cabbage rolls are a delicious dish made by rolling a filling, often including ground meat and rice, in blanched cabbage leaves and then cooking them in a flavorful sauce. Here’s a basic recipe to guide you through the process:
Ingredients: For the cabbage rolls:
- 1 large green cabbage
- 1 pound (450g) ground meat (beef, pork, chicken, or a mixture)
- 1 cup cooked rice
- 1 on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 egg
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 teaspoon dried herbs (such as thyme, oregano, or parsley)
For the sauce:
- 2 cups tomato sauce or crushed tomatoes
- 1 cup broth (chicken or vegetable)
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 teaspoon sugar (optional)
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Prepare the Cabbage Leaves:
- Bring a large pot of water to boil.
- Carefully remove the core of the cabbage using a knife.
- Place the whole cabbage into the boiling water for a few minutes until the outer leaves start to soften and can be peeled off easily.
- Remove the cabbage from the water and gently peel off the leaves one by one. You may need to put the cabbage back into the boiling water for a few more minutes if the leaves are still too firm.
- Prepare the Filling:
- In a mixing bowl, combine the ground meat, cooked rice, chopped onion, minced garlic, egg, dried herbs, salt, and pepper. Mix well until all the ingredients are evenly combined.
- Assemble the Cabbage Rolls:
- Take a cabbage leaf and trim the tough center stem if necessary.
- Place a spoonful of the filling onto the center of the cabbage leaf.
- Fold in the sides of the leaf and then roll it up tightly, similar to how you would roll a burrito. Repeat with the remaining leaves and filling.
- Prepare the Sauce:
- In a separate bowl, mix together the tomato sauce or crushed tomatoes, broth, olive oil, sugar (if using), salt, and pepper.
- Cook the Cabbage Rolls:
- Spread a thin layer of the sauce on the bottom of a large pot or a baking dish.
- Arrange the cabbage rolls seam-side down in the pot or dish.
- Pour the remaining sauce over the cabbage rolls.
- Cooking Options:
- Stovetop: Cover the pot and simmer on low heat for about 45 minutes to 1 hour, or until the cabbage leaves are tender and the filling is cooked.
- Oven: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il and bake at 350°F (175°C) for about 1 to 1.5 hours.
- Serve:
- Once cooked, carefully remove the cabbage rolls from the pot or baking dish.
- Serve the cabbage rolls hot, with some of the sauce spooned over them.
